php数组

#php数组#汇总了IT技术网“#php数组#”最新消息,包括#php数组#最新文章、图片等,致力于打造准确全面的#php数组#栏目,让您第一时间了解到关于#php数组#的热门信息。IT技术网小编将持续从百度新闻、搜狗百科、微博热搜、知乎热门问答以及部分合作站点渠道收集和补充完善信息。
  • <b>php用什么函数可实现数组反转</b>

    php用什么函数可实现数组反转

    在PHP中,可以使用array_reverse()函数来实现数组反转。array_reverse()函数会将数组中的元素顺序翻转,创建新的数组并返回,语法为“array_reverse(array,preserve)”;参数preserve...[详细]

    发布时间:2022-09-16 19:46:17
  • <b>php怎么判断数组中指定值是不是最后一个元素</b>

    php怎么判断数组中指定值是不是最后一个元素

    两种判断方法:1、利用end()函数和“===”运算符,获取数组最后一个元素的值,比较该元素值是否为指定值即可,语法“end($arr==="指定值")”,如果相等则是,反之则不是。2、利用array_pop()函数和“===”运算符,语法...[详细]

    发布时间:2022-09-15 19:28:34
  • <b>php怎么将数组转为json数据</b>

    php怎么将数组转为json数据

    在php中,可以使用json_encode()函数来将数组转化为json格式数据,语法为“json_encode(数组变量,$options)”。json_encode()函数能对PHP变量进行JSON编码,如果转化成功则返回JSON格式数...[详细]

    发布时间:2022-09-15 19:28:21
  • <b>php怎么对数组逆向排序且不保留键名</b>

    php怎么对数组逆向排序且不保留键名

    实现步骤:1、利用array_reverse()函数对数组进行逆向排序,语法“array_reverse(原数组)”,会返回一个逆向数组;2、使用array_values()函数重置逆向数组的键名,语法“array_values(逆向数组)...[详细]

    发布时间:2022-09-14 19:46:46
  • <b>php foreach可以遍历三维数组吗</b>

    php foreach可以遍历三维数组吗

    可以遍历。在php中,可以通过嵌套三层foreach语句来遍历三维数组,语法为“foreach($array as $k1=>$v1){foreach($v1 as $k2=>$v2){foreach($v2 as $k3=>$v3){.....[详细]

    发布时间:2022-09-14 19:20:53
  • <b>php一维数组怎么升序排序(不去重)</b>

    php一维数组怎么升序排序(不去重)

    升序排序的三种方法:1、使用sort()函数,可对数组元素进行升序排序,语法“sort($arr,排序模式);”;2、使用asort()函数,可根据关联数组的键值进行升序排列,语法“asort($arr,排序模式)”;3、使用ksort()...[详细]

    发布时间:2022-09-13 19:21:20
  • <b>php怎么获得数组中不重复元素的个数</b>

    php怎么获得数组中不重复元素的个数

    实现步骤:1、用array_count_values()统计元素出现次数,返回一个关联数组;2、遍历关联数组,判断值是否为1,如果为1则取出对应键名,并将其赋值给一个空数组,语法“foreach(关联数组 as $k=>$v){if($v=...[详细]

    发布时间:2022-09-13 19:21:09
  • <b>php怎么判断数组所有值是否都不为空</b>

    php怎么判断数组所有值是否都不为空

    步骤:1、使用array_filter()函数过滤数组,语法“array_filter(原数组);”,会返回一个包含所有不为空元素的数组;2、使用count()函数获取原数组和过滤数组的长度,并比较两数组长度是否相等,语法“count(原数...[详细]

    发布时间:2022-09-09 20:35:32
  • <b>php如何实现二维数组排序</b>

    php如何实现二维数组排序

    在php中,可以使用array_multisort()函数实现二维数组排序。该函数可以对多个数组或多维数组进行排序,语法“array_multisort(二维数组,排列顺序,排序类型)”;当第二个参数省略或设置为“SORT_ASC”则升序排...[详细]

    发布时间:2022-09-08 20:35:35
  • <b>php怎么实现对字符串的排序</b>

    php怎么实现对字符串的排序

    实现步骤:1、利用str_split()函数将字符串转为字符数组,语法“str_split(字符串)”;2、使用asort()或arsort()函数来对字符数组进行升序排序或降序排序,语法“asort(字符数组)”或“arsort(字符数组...[详细]

    发布时间:2022-09-08 20:10:43
  • <b>php怎么判断数组是否为二维数组</b>

    php怎么判断数组是否为二维数组

    两种判断方法:1、利用count()函数比较省略第二参数和不省略第二参数时,获取的长度是否一样即可,语法“count($arr)!=count($arr,1)”,返回值为true则是二维数组,反之则不是。2、用foreach语句循环遍历数组...[详细]

    发布时间:2022-09-07 19:46:06
  • <b>php怎么去掉数组的第一个值</b>

    php怎么去掉数组的第一个值

    两种删除方法:1、使用array_shift()函数删除数组的第一个值,语法“array_shift($arr)”,会返回被删除的元素。2、使用array_splice()函数删除第一个值,语法“array_splice($arr,0,1)...[详细]

    发布时间:2022-09-06 19:52:26
  • <b>php遍历一个数组的三种方法是什么</b>

    php遍历一个数组的三种方法是什么

    3种遍历数组的方法:1、用for语句遍历,语法“for($i=0;$i<数组长度;$i++){//循环代码}”;2、用foreach语句遍历,语法“foreach($arr as $k=>$v){//循环代码}”;3、用while配合eac...[详细]

    发布时间:2022-09-06 19:36:02
  • <b>php二维数组怎么求积</b>

    php二维数组怎么求积

    求积步骤:1、定义一个变量并赋值1,语法“$cj=1;”;2、用foreach循环遍历外层数组元素,语法“foreach($arr as $v){//循环体代码}”;3、循环体中,用is_array()、array_product()和“*...[详细]

    发布时间:2022-09-06 19:35:46
  • <b>php怎么取两个数组的不同值</b>

    php怎么取两个数组的不同值

    3种取不同值的方法:1、比较数组键值并返回一个包含不同值的差集数组,语法“array_diff(数组1,数组2)”。2、比较数组键名并返回一个包含不同值的差集数组,语法“array_diff_key(数组1,数组2)”。3、比较数组的键名和...[详细]

    发布时间:2022-09-01 19:46:23
  • <b>php怎么比较两个数组去除相同的元素</b>

    php怎么比较两个数组去除相同的元素

    实现步骤:1、用array_intersect()比较两个数组并获取相同元素,语法“array_intersect(原数组1,原数组2)”,会返回一个包含相同元素的交集数组;2、用array_diff()分别将两个原数组和交集数组进行对比,...[详细]

    发布时间:2022-09-01 19:20:42
  • <b>php数组怎么添加和删除元素</b>

    php数组怎么添加和删除元素

    添加方法:1、array_unshift()在开头插入元素,语法“array_unshift(数组,元素列表)”;2、array_push()在末尾插入元素,语法“array_push(数组,元素)”。删除方法:1、array_shift(...[详细]

    发布时间:2022-08-30 19:47:36
  • <b>php怎么检测数组中是否有指定值</b>

    php怎么检测数组中是否有指定值

    3种方法:1、用foreach语句和“==”运算符,语法“foreach($arr as $v){if($v==指定值){//存在}}”。2、用in_array(),语法“in_array("指定值",数组)”,返回TRUE则存在,反之不存...[详细]

    发布时间:2022-08-30 19:20:21
  • <b>php数组怎么去掉某个字符串</b>

    php数组怎么去掉某个字符串

    两种方法:1、使用array_search()和array_splice()删除,语法“array_splice($arr,array_search("字符串",$arr,true),1);”。2、利用foreach语句和unset()删除...[详细]

    发布时间:2022-08-26 20:35:14
  • <b>php数组转字符串可以吗</b>

    php数组转字符串可以吗

    php数组可以转字符串。3种转换方法:1、用implode()函数,可以将一个一维数组转化为字符串,语法“implode(分隔符,数组)”;2、用join()函数,返回一个由数组元素组合成的字符串,语法“join(分隔符,数组)”;3、利用...[详细]

    发布时间:2022-08-26 20:10:10
  • <b>php数组怎么用while求和</b>

    php数组怎么用while求和

    求和步骤:1、定义一个变量赋值0,用于存储求和结果,语法“$sum=0;”;2、利用while语句和each()、list()函数来遍历数组,语法“while(list($key,$val)=each($arr)) {//循环体语句块;}”...[详细]

    发布时间:2022-08-24 18:55:37
  • <b>php二维数组中指定字段怎么求和</b>

    php二维数组中指定字段怎么求和

    求和步骤:1、使用array_column()函数获取二维数组中指定字段(列)的全部元素,语法“array_column(二维数组, '指定字段名')”,会返回一个包含指定字段全部元素的结果数组;2、使用array_sum()函数计算结果数...[详细]

    发布时间:2022-08-24 18:33:03
  • <b>php怎么查询指定值是数组中的第几个元素</b>

    php怎么查询指定值是数组中的第几个元素

    查询步骤:1、利用array_values()函数重置数组键名,将数组转为索引数组,语法“array_values(数组)”;2、利用array_search()函数获取指定值在索引数组中的位置(索引值+1)即可,语法“array_sear...[详细]

    发布时间:2022-08-23 20:11:16
  • <b>php交换数组键与值用什么函数</b>

    php交换数组键与值用什么函数

    php交换数组键与值用“array_flip()”函数。array_flip()函数用于交换数组中的键名和对应关联的键值,语法“array_flip(array);”,参数array表示需进行键和值对交换的数组;如果交换成功则返回交换后的数...[详细]

    发布时间:2022-08-23 19:46:18
  • <b>将数组分成几段的php函数是什么</b>

    将数组分成几段的php函数是什么

    将数组分成几段的php函数是“array_chunk()”。array_chunk()函数可以把一个数组分割成多个子数组,并将这些子数组组成一个多维数组来返回,分割的每个子数组的元素个数由该函数的第二个参数决定;语法为“array_chun...[详细]

    发布时间:2022-08-23 19:46:12
php数组